Museum Overview and Specialties
This museum functions as both a museum and a history museum, serving as a significant tourist attraction within the region. The center’s collection meticulously documents the area’s history, predominantly focusing on the impact of the Gold Rush era. Visitors will discover a diverse array of exhibits, spread across four distinct rooms, each dedicated to a particular facet of local heritage.
These rooms showcase:
Coulterville History: Delving into the origins and development of the town itself.
Cultural Artifacts: Providing insights into the daily life and traditions of the early settlers.
Mining Equipment: A fascinating display of tools and machinery used during the gold mining boom.
Outdoor Exhibits: On occasion, visitors may discover additional artifacts displayed outside the main building, adding an element of surprise and discovery.
The museum is particularly renowned for its preservation of locally donated artifacts, reflecting a strong community connection to its past.
